The median sold price in Playhouse Yard is £136,250, based on 14 sales recorded by HM Land Registry.
Over the past decade prices in Playhouse Yard are +22% in cash terms, and −32% after adjusting for inflation (ONS CPIH).
The median is £2,237 per square metre, from EPC floor-area records.
Figures update monthly from HM Land Registry. The most recent sale here was recorded on 16 September 2021; the latest two months may be incomplete while sales register.
